In recent years, Colorado has emerged as a key player in the international trade arena, with the state experiencing unprecedented growth in exports and imports. According to the latest data released by the Colorado Office of Economic Development and International Trade, the state saw a 15% increase in trade volume in the first quarter of 2026 compared to the same period last year.One of the driving forces behind this growth has been the state's diverse economy, which includes a strong presence in industries such as aerospace, technology, and agriculture. Colorado has become a hub for innovation and entrepreneurship, attracting businesses from around the world looking to tap into its skilled workforce and favorable business climate.The aerospace sector, in particular, has been a standout performer in Colorado's international trade landscape. With companies like Lockheed Martin and Ball Aerospace leading the way, the state has solidified its reputation as a global leader in aerospace technology. In 2026, aerospace exports from Colorado increased by a staggering 25%, reaching a total value of $2.5 billion.In addition to aerospace, Colorado has also seen significant growth in its technology sector, with companies like Google, Amazon, and Salesforce expanding their operations in the state. Technology exports from Colorado grew by 18% in the first quarter of 2026, driven by increased demand for digital services and software products.Furthermore, Colorado's agricultural industry has also played a pivotal role in the state's international trade success. Colorado is known for its high-quality produce, including beef, lamb, and dairy products, which have found a strong market in countries like Japan, South Korea, and Mexico. Agricultural exports from Colorado increased by 12% in 2026, reaching a total value of $1.3 billion.Overall, Colorado's international trade growth has had a positive impact on the state's economy, creating jobs, attracting investment, and boosting revenue. The state government has been proactive in supporting trade initiatives, offering incentives and resources to help businesses expand internationally.Looking ahead, Colorado is poised to continue its upward trajectory in international trade, with projections pointing towards sustained growth in the coming years. By leveraging its strengths in key industries and fostering a business-friendly environment, Colorado is set to solidify its position as a global trade powerhouse in the years to come.
